发布网友 发布时间:2022-04-27 04:27
共1个回答
热心网友 时间:2022-06-26 05:12
% eval(['A(:,',num2str(i),')=', 'mat2cell(a(:,i),repmat(1,length(a(:,i)),1))',';'])在A=[];下输入您的答案,结果为:
若A先定为一个cell, 再输入:
则A{1,1}是一个 5X1的cell
请问:为什么在A=[];下报错 而在A是cell下有结果呢?
我希望a(i)=1:3;
那么A=
[1]
[2]
[3]
另问:为了达到这样的效果应该怎么改呢?